ZIP 12754 and ZIP 12762 are ZIP Code areas in New York.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 12754 has the higher population (8,525 vs 453 in ZIP 12762). ZIP 12762 has the higher median household income ($112,545 vs $56,597 in ZIP 12754). ZIP 12762 has the higher median home value ($413,400 vs $190,700 in ZIP 12754).
